The distance between Ngukurr and Darwin is 573 km.
It takes approximately 5h 9m to get from Ngukurr to Darwin, including transfers.

What companies run services between Ngukurr, NT, Australia and Darwin, NT, Australia?
There is no direct connection from Ngukurr to Darwin. However, you can travel to Maningrida Airport (MNG) airport, fly to Darwin International Airport (DRW), then take the taxi to Darwin. Alternatively, you can travel to Katherine (KTR) airport, fly to Darwin International Airport (DRW), then take the taxi to Darwin.
